Tabreed’s general assembly approves AED 441m dividend payout for 2024

Dubai - Mubasher: The annual general assembly meeting of National Central Cooling Company (Tabreed) has approved a dividend payment of 15.50 fils per share, exceeding AED 441 million, for 2024.

Over the past five years, Tabreed has delivered a total shareholder return of 96% in the form of share price increases and dividends, according to a press release.

At the end of December 2024, the company achieved record revenues and a 32% increase in net profit after tax.

Tabreed’s Chairman, Bakheet Al Katheeri, commented: “Tabreed has entered 2025 with impressive momentum, already having raised $700 million via its inaugural, five-year green sukuk, and entering a new joint venture with Dubai Holding to supply sustainable district cooling to one of the UAE’s most exciting real estate projects, Palm Jebel Ali.”

“Tabreed’s balance sheet is stronger than ever, and there is a strong pipeline of promising opportunities ahead. It undoubtedly remains a safe haven for existing and future shareholders alike,” Al Katheeri stated.

During 2024, Tabreed completed two new plants and added 23,576 refrigeration tonnes [RTs] of new connections across the company’s portfolio, in the UAE, Saudi Arabia, Oman, Egypt and India.

Tabreed recorded a 5% growth in consumption volumes to 2.66 billion refrigeration ton hours (RTH).
